I Need Help With Some Weight Loss Advice. I Am Wanting To Lose About 30 Pounds.?

Currently I am 5′7″ and I weigh 170 pounds. I do NOT want to pack on muscle right now…I want to melt away the fat and lose weight. I’m about to go back on Weight Watchers which I did years ago and had success with it. What can I do and how often do I need to do it? I have a gym membership too…thanks!

    In addition to 60 minutes of cardio a day (Walking, jogging, swimming, dancing, or jumping rope are great!) I do ab circuits multiple times daily. These help you get toned which equals a sexy body which equals more confidence. When your body feels stronger, your confidence shines through.
    *100 crunches
    *50 bicycle crunches
    *25 leg lifts
    *balance your weight on your right elbow (20 seconds)
    *balance your weight on your left elbow (20 seconds)
    *20 push-ups
    Tip: always keep your abs tight (even when sitting or walking)
    Diet: eat foods low in sodium to counteract bloating of the stomach; eat healthy food all around
    For arms, legs, etc. I use resistance bands, weights, and do squats and lunges (50 lunges at a time and 25 squats at a time).
    Small changes are a key to starting a healthier lifestyle
    *Take the stairs instead of the elevator.
    *Walk up the escalator if there aren’t stairs.
    *During a break from work, just go outside and walk (you’ll be more inspired to keep at it if it’s outside on a pretty day) or do a few squats.
    *Start small: Do a few crunches/ push-ups each day, and steadily increase the number.
    *Even though your schedule is busy, try to fit in at least 30 minutes of walking or some other cardio. (jogging, swimming, jumping rope)
    *Turn on some upbeat music and just dance… At home, this isn’t embarrassing or anything. Just relax and dance; it’s really fun!
    *Throw out all the junk food in your house, and don’t let yourself buy any… When you’re tempted to buy/eat junk food, picture yourself as gorgeous and thin… that’ll keep your focus on the goal.
    *Switch to whole grain foods; they are much healthier.
    *Choose healthier snacks… We’re always tempted by sugary and high calorie snacks like we find in vending machines. Instead pack an apple, a rice cake (they are REALLY good), or a nutrition bar.
    *Add more servings of fruits and vegetables; it’s tough, but they are healthy and can fill you up faster.
    *When fixing a meal, prepare everything then put up the bags, boxes, etc. so you won’t be tempted by seconds.
    *Brush your teeth right before and after a meal. It will curb your appetite.
    *Eat slowly and take smaller bites because the “I’m full” hormones will be signalled better.
